BLUETOOTH® Improve the voice quality While talking on the phone... 1 Press the volume knob to enter [FUNCTION]. 2 Turn the volume knob to select an item (see the following table), then press the knob. 3 Repeat step 2 until the desired item is selected or activated. 4 Press and hold to exit. To return to the previous setting item, press . MIC GAIN NR LEVEL ECHO CANCEL Default: XX -10 - +10 (-4): The sensitivity of the microphone increases as the number increased. -5 - +5 (0): Adjust the noise reduction level until the least noise is being heard during a phone conversation. -5 - +5 (0): Adjust the echo cancellation delay time until the least echo is being heard during a phone conversation. Make the settings for receiving a call 1 Press to enter Bluetooth mode. 2 Turn the volume knob to select an item (see the following table), then press the knob. 3 Repeat step 2 until the desired item is selected or activated. 4 Press and hold to exit. To return to the previous setting item, press . Make a call You can make a call from the call history, phonebook, or dialing the number. Call by voice is also possible if your mobile phone has the feature. 1 Press to enter Bluetooth mode. 2 Turn the volume knob to select an item (see the following table), then press the knob. 3 Repeat step 2 until the desired item is selected/ activated or follow the instructions stated on the selected item. 4 Press and hold to exit. To return to the previous setting item, press . CALL HISTORY (Applicable only if the phone supports PBAP) 1 Press the volume knob to select a name or a phone number. • "INCOMING", "OUTGOING", or "MISSED" is shown on the lower part of the display to indicate the previous call status. • Press DISP to change the display category (NUMBER or NAME). • "NO DATA" appears if there is no recorded call history. 2 Press the volume knob to call. Default: XX SETTINGS AUTO ANSWER 1 - 30: The unit answers incoming call automatically in the selected time (in seconds). ; OFF: Cancels. BATT/SIGNAL* AUTO: Shows the strength of the battery and signal when the unit detects a Bluetooth device and the Bluetooth device is connected. ; OFF: Cancels.
